Data Software Engineering & 5 others
EPAM Systems
Software Engineering
Colombia · Remote
Posted on Nov 19, 2025
Responsibilities
- Develop and maintain services for the Insurance Company client
- Process data using Python to generate insights and reports
- Build and maintain REST APIs for seamless integration with other systems
- Collaborate with cross-functional teams, including Product Managers and Data Scientists, to deliver high-quality solutions
- Participate in code reviews and ensure code quality and adherence to best practices
- Work with Docker and MongoDB to implement efficient and scalable solutions
- Mentor junior developers and contribute to their technical growth
- Stay up-to-date with the latest Python development trends and technologies
Requirements
- 3+ years of experience in Python development, with a focus on Python.Core
- Experience with Docker for containerization
- Knowledge of PySpark
- Proficiency in working with MongoDB for data storage and retrieval
- Knowledge of Python data processing libraries and frameworks
- Experience in building and maintaining REST APIs
- B2+ English level proficiency
We offer/Benefits
- International projects with top brands
- Work with global teams of highly skilled, diverse peers
- Healthcare benefits
- Employee financial programs
- Paid time off and sick leave
- Upskilling, reskilling and certification courses
- Unlimited access to the LinkedIn Learning library and 22,000+ courses
- Global career opportunities
- Volunteer and community involvement opportunities
- EPAM Employee Groups
- Award-winning culture recognized by Glassdoor, Newsweek and LinkedIn